(Symbol: HDRN) Contact: Amber Gordon Ron Alexander (703) 329-9400 HADRON ANNOUNCES 2001 ANNUAL EARNINGS Alexandria, VA, February 12, 2002 -- HADRON, INC. (OTC BB: HDRN) today announced its earnings for 2001. For the year ended December 31, 2001, the Company reported operating income of $475,400 and net income of $197,900 ($0.02 net income per share) versus operating income of $250,000 and a net loss of $29,000 (a $0.01 net loss per share) for the twelve months ended December 31, 2000. For 2001, Hadron reported revenues of $21.9 million versus $18.6 million for the twelve months ended December 31, 2000. In February 2001, Hadron changed its fiscal year end from June 30 to December 31. Hadron's earnings before interest, taxes, depreciation and amortization (EBITDA) for 2001 were $961,700. The Company's profitability was achieved through a combination of acquisition, internally generated growth and strong control of overhead costs. For the fourth quarter, ended December 31, 2001 Hadron reported consolidated revenues of $9.2 million, operating income of $188,400 and net income of $50,100 (or $0.004 net income per share). This compares to revenues of $4.2 million, operating income of $53,600 and net income of $22,200 for the quarter ended December 31, 2000. HADRON specializes in developing intelligence and biodefense solutions in support of our Nation's security. Hadron focuses on developing innovative technical solutions for the intelligence community; designing, developing and testing aerospace products and systems; analyzing and supporting defense systems; and developing medical defenses and treatments for toxic agents used in biological warfare and terrorism.
